Reduce space heating costs … adjust the thermostat SettingTimeSetpoint Temperature wake6≤ 70° F day8Setback at least 8° F evening6≤ 70° F sleep10Setback at least 8° F

ONE TWO THREE Change filters Close damper Schedule tune-ups More Ways to Reduce Space Heating Costs

Add insulation Check ductwork Even More Ways to Reduce Space Heating Costs! Photo: U.S. Department of Energy

What to do about space cooling… SettingTimeSetpoint Temperature wake6≥ 78° F day8Setup at least 7° F evening6≥ 78° F sleep10Setup at least 4° F

STEP ACTION ONE TWO THREE FOUR Use less hot water Turn down thermostat Insulate water heater Upgrade efficiency 4 Ways to Reduce Water Heating Costs

STEP ACTION ONE TWO THREE FOUR Cover and wrap food Close door Test door seal Check temperature 4 Ways to Reduce Refrigeration Costs
